The story is framed by Francis’ initial failure of nerve, although Hemingway chooses to begin the story in the aftermath of this event, and then reveal what happened to us only later, during a flashback. The husband has a failure of nerve when faced with a lion during one of their hunts, and his wife loses respect for him.Ĭourage and cowardice are central, mutually complementary themes in ‘The Short Happy Life of Francis Macomber’. First published in Cosmopolitan magazine in 1936, ‘The Short Happy Life of Francis Macomber’ is about a married American couple on safari in Africa with their English guide. This is a popular Ernest Hemingway story with a decidedly atypical un-Hemingwayesque protagonist. ![]()
